Hi, Stuart - and thanks for your questions.

My thought is that you can eliminate the short briefing after lunch.
Remember: You told them the guidelines, then got out of their way. You don’t want to break into their flow. In your introduction you can say ‘now we are moving into our first session but you can add a topic to the wall at any time.’ 

My question - why do you have news and then closing - to me, news is (for example) a report from the Newsroom Coordinator, a note about dinner / evening activities, then on to closing comments and reflection. Could take 30 minutes for news and announcements maybe, then an hour for Closing Circle, no? Thanks for sharing if you have something else in mind.

By the way - depending on how you are doing documentation design, I often create an extra 30 minutes before going into closing so folks can catch up on transcribing / completing their notes. Other folks just chat and enjoy snacks and such. 

I love not shortening sessions to 45 minutes. If they are too short, only the quick responders get to participate. Less so, the reflective thinkers. You want full diversity.

> Hi All
> 
> I’m facilitating a full day open space event next week and the client has suggested some of the following ideas, based on advice during open space training from another company:
> 
> a.       Opening: 9 to 10
> b.      Session 1: 10  to 11 (Morning sessions are more for people to set the stage, so having 2 before lunch to get people feel comfortable of Open Space)
> c.       Session 2: 11 to 12
> d.      Lunch: 12 to 13
> e.      Short briefing: 13, to remind that adding any topics any time is welcome
> f.        Session 3: 13 to 14 (Usually conversations with energy happens in the afternoon)
> g.       Session 4: 14 to 15
> h.      Session 5: 15 to 16
> i.         News: 16 to 17
> j.        Closing: 17 to 18
> 
> 
> I wasn’t going to schedule a reserved time for lunch and was thinking of 45 minute sessions. I also wasn’t intending to have a news hour.
> 
> I value your suggestions and advice for facilitating this. For most attendees it will be their first full day open space event and the first with a real diversity in attendees.
